About Sigurd Støren

Sigurd Støren is a scholar working on Mechanics of Materials, Mechanical Engineering, Materials Chemistry, Strategy and Management and Environmental Chemistry, having authored 16 papers that have together received 853 indexed citations. Recurring topics across this work include Metallurgy and Material Forming (8 papers), Metal Forming Simulation Techniques (5 papers), Microstructure and mechanical properties (3 papers), Powder Metallurgy Techniques and Materials (3 papers), Sustainable Supply Chain Management (2 papers), Sustainable Industrial Ecology (2 papers), Chemistry and Chemical Engineering (2 papers) and Aluminum Alloy Microstructure Properties (2 papers). The work is most often cited by research in Mechanics of Materials (599 citations), Mechanical Engineering (654 citations), Materials Chemistry (415 citations), Marketing (51 citations) and Strategy and Management (61 citations). Sigurd Støren has collaborated with scholars based in Norway, India and United States. Frequent co-authors include J. R. Rice, Casper Boks, Anindya Deb, S. Ranganatha, Helge Brattebø, T. S. Srivatsan and Satish V. Kailas. Their work appears in journals such as Journal of Cleaner Production, Creativity and Innovation Management, International Journal of Mechanical Sciences, Journal of Industrial Ecology and Journal of the Mechanics and Physics of Solids.
